Abstract:
The traditional statistical and rule combination algorithm lacks the determination of the inner cohesion of words, and the N-gram algorithm does not limit the length of N, which will produce a large number of invalid word strings, consume time and reduce the efficiency of the experiment. Therefore, this article first constructs a Chinese neologism corpus, adopts improved multi-PMI, and sets a double threshold to filter new words. Branch entropy is used to calculate the probabilities between words. Finally, the N-gram algorithm is used to segment the preprocessed corpus. We use multi-word mutual information and a double mutual information threshold to identify new words and improve their recognition accuracy. Experimental results show that the algorithm proposed in this article has been improved in accuracy, recall and F measures value by 7%, 3% and 5% respectively, which can promote the sharing of language information resources so that people can intuitively and accurately obtain language information services from the internet.

Functional Classification of Joints
The functional classification of joints is determined by the amount of mobility between the adjacent bones. Joints are functionally classified as a synarthrosis or immobile joint, an amphiarthrosis or slightly moveable joint, or as a diarthrosis, a freely moveable joint. Fibrous and cartilaginous joints can be functionally classified as either synarthroses or amphiarthroses, whereas all synovial joints are classified as diarthroses.
